Calculate Log Base 237 of 9

To solve the equation log 237 (9) = x carry out the following steps.
  1. Apply the change of base rule:
    log a (x) = log b (x) / log b (a)
    With b = 10:
    log a (x) = log(x) / log(a)
  2. Substitute the variables:
    With x = 9, a = 237:
    log 237 (9) = log(9) / log(237)
  3. Evaluate the term:
    log(9) / log(237)
    = 1.39794000867204 / 1.92427928606188
    = 0.40182889738299
    = Logarithm of 9 with base 237
